Summary
(From the publisher):
The sequence of The Circle Game originally appeared as a series of lithographs by the Toronto artist Charles Pachter. Contents:
- This is a Photograph of Me
- After the Flood, We
- A Messenger
- Evening Trainstation, Before Departure
- An Attempted Solution for Chess Problems
- In My Ravines
- A Descent Through the Carpet
- Playing Cards
- Man with a Hook
- The City Planners
- On the Streets, Love
- Eventual Proteus
- A Meal
- The Circle Game
- Camera
- Winter Sleepers
- Spring in the Igloo
- A Sibyl
- Migration: C.P.R.
- Journey to the Interior
- Some Objects of Wood and Stone
- Pre-Amphibian
- Against Still Life
- The Islands
- Letters, Towards and Away
- A Place: Fragments
- The Explorers
- The Settlers
